History and Growth:
Online poker surfaced in the belated 1990s as a result of developments in technology and internet. The initial on-line poker area, Planet Poker, was launched in 1998, attracting a little but passionate neighborhood. But was at the first 2000s that internet poker experienced exponential development, mostly as a result of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
